Ukhnaagiin Khurelsukh is the President of Mongolia, having taken office in June 2021. He is a member of the Mongolian People's Party and previously served as the Prime Minister of Mongolia from 2017 to 2021. Khurelsukh has focused on strengthening Mongolia's economy and foreign relations, particularly with its neighbors, Russia and China. He was mentioned in recent news regarding the upcoming Victory Day parade in Moscow, where he received an invitation to attend.

Born on Jun 01, 1970 (55 years old)
